About Una Hwang

Una Hwang is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ics, Computational Mechanics, Statistical and Nonlinear Physics and Instrumentation, having authored 59 papers that have together received 2.2k indexed citations. Recurring topics across this work include Gamma-ray bursts and supernovae (50 papers), Astrophysics and Cosmic Phenomena (50 papers), Astrophysical Phenomena and Observations (20 papers), Pulsars and Gravitational Waves Research (12 papers), Solar and Space Plasma Dynamics (10 papers), Astrophysics and Star Formation Studies (4 papers), Galaxies: Formation, Evolution, Phenomena (4 papers) and Astronomical Observations and Instrumentation (3 papers). The work is most often cited by research in Nuclear and High Energy Physics (1.7k citations), Astronomy and Astrophysics (2.1k citations), Instrumentation (20 citations), Geophysics (60 citations) and Radiation (32 citations). Una Hwang has collaborated with scholars based in United States, Japan and United Kingdom. Frequent co-authors include Robert Petre, E. V. Gotthelf, John P. Hughes, J. M. Laming, S. S. Holt, Kazimierz J. Borkowski, Masanori Ozaki, K. Koyama, M. Matsuura and Stephen S. Holt. Their work appears in journals such as The Astrophysical Journal, The Astrophysical Journal Letters, Advances in Space Research, Monthly Notices of the Royal Astronomical Society Letters and Monthly Notices of the Royal Astronomical Society.
